Question - The Super Bowl Company makes and sells glass bowls. At the beginning of the year, the company has established the following monthly cost information regarding the production of their bowls:

  • Direct Materials: 4 ounces per unit at $3.00 per ounce
  • Direct Labor: 2 hours per unit at $10.00 per hour
  • Manufacturing Overhead Rate: $0.25 per DL dollar
  • Administrative Expenses (Salaries): $3,000 per month
  • Bad debt expense: 5% of credit sales
  • Shipping expenses (to customers): $1.00 per bowl
  • Sales commissions: $4.00 per bowl
  • Depreciation: $500 per month
  • Selling price: $60 per bowl

The company also anticipates the following unit sales budgeted for the first four months of the year:

January

February

March

April

May

1,000

1,400

1,600

1,500

2,000

Based on the sales budget, what is the budgeted level of sales (in dollars) for the month of February?

a. $60,000

b. $84,000

c. $90,000

d. $96,000
